titleOfInvention Preparation of granular starch derivatives
abstract DERIVATIVES OF STARCH HERETOFORE UNATTAINABLE BY AQUEOUS REACTION TECHNIQUES AS WELL AS INCREASED EFFICIENCY OF ATTAINABLE DERIVATIVE FORMULATIONS BY AQUEOUS REACTION TECHNIQUES ARE ACHIEVED BY REACTING A HYDROPHOBIC REAGENT WITH A GRANULAR STARCH IN A THREE PHASE SYSTEM COMPRISED OF (1) GRANULAR STARCH (2) WATER, AND (3) A HYDROPHOBIC REAGENT WHICH IS EMULSIFIED IN THE CONTINUOUS AQUEOUS PHASE BY AN EMULSIFIER.
